Former Miss Michigan USA Kenya Bell has been revealed as one of the new cast members of the original “Basketball Wives” show. Kenya was arrested just this past May for stabbing her husband, Golden State Warrior Charlie Bell (Charlie Bell’s Wife Kenya Releases Statement On Domestic Violence Charges). And it all happened in front of their 2 children. Supposedly they were in the process of a divorce, but are still technically married.
The second new cast member is Kesha Ni’cole Nichols. If you recall, her ex fiance’ San Antonio Spur Richard Jefferson pretty much left her at the alter. He called off their $2 million wedding just days before–via EMAIL–and didn’t tell the wedding guests until the day OF! He promised her a 6-figure concession check, but reneged. And locked her out of their apartment.
